ONE NIGHT. TWO PEOPLE. JUST THE TRUTH OR SOMEONE’S VERSION OF IT.

Hailed as a ‘powerful, pulsating power play’ (Reviews Hub) Interview is a ‘thought-provoking’ (The Times) ‘electric dance of power which questions who really wields influence’ (The Guardian). 

Paten Hughes is ‘absolutely superb’ (Theatre and Tonic) as Katya, a fiercely intelligent influencer turned movie star, who is sick of being underestimated, objectified and misrepresented by journalists...especially the male ones.

When the fading political journalist Pierre Peters, played by the ‘utterly brilliant’ (Stage to Page) Robert Sean Leonard, is assigned to interview her, he’s bitter and dismissive, but Katya has her own reasons for agreeing to the encounter. A tense evening in her Brooklyn apartment swiftly spirals into a volatile game of confession, confrontation, and manipulation. ‘Their chemistry sizzles together’ (Theatre and Tonic)

Tony Award® winner Robert Sean Leonard (HBO’s The Gilded Age; House; Dead Poets Society; Broadway: The Invention of Love (Tony Award®)) and Paten Hughes (A View From the Bridge; Stolen Girl; Heirloom) star in the World Premiere of Interview, a seductive 2-hander stage adaptation of Theo Van Gogh’s cult film about truth, persona, and gender power. 

Playing at Riverside Studios until 27 September 2025
